引言:理解Web3与权限申请

在数字时代,Web3作为下一代互联网架构,致力于通过去中心化技术(如区块链)赋予用户更大的控制权。Web3强调用户主权,用户在使用各类去中心化应用(dApp)时,通常需要申请权限,以便访问特定功能或数据。然而,如何在这一环境中安全申请和管理权限,是每一个Web3用户需要关注的重要问题。

在Web3中,用户通常需要通过数字钱包与智能合约交互,并且这些交互常常要求用户授权,以确定访问权限或交易的合法性。由于Web3的去中心化特性,这些授权行为的安全性直接影响用户的资产安全。因此,在申请权限时,用户需要掌握一些基本的安全知识和操作技巧。

Web3中权限申请的必要性

在Web3生态系统中,大多数dApp为用户提供各种服务,例如去中心化金融(DeFi)、非同质化代币(NFT)交易、社交网络等。这些服务通常需要用户提供一定的权限来完成特定的操作。例如,用户想要在去中心化交易所进行交易,需要授予该交易所访问其特定资产的权限。

权限申请的必要性主要体现在以下几个方面:

  • 保护用户资产:通过权限管理,用户可以控制哪些dApp可以访问其钱包资产,保障资产安全。
  • 确保交易合法性:在进行交易时,必须进行授权,以便确认用户的操作从权威来源发起。
  • 提升用户体验:合理的权限申请可以减少用户在使用过程中重复授权的麻烦,从而增强用户体验。

如何安全地申请权限

在Web3中,安全申请权限的过程通常包括几个关键步骤。用户需要对每一个步骤保持警觉,以确保其权限申请不被滥用。

步骤一:验证dApp的合法性

在申请权限之前,用户首先需要验证所使用的dApp是否合法。这可以通过查阅社区评价、官方网站信息以及开发者的背景来进行。用户可以加入相关的社交媒体群组、论坛,了解其他用户的使用体验,从而对dApp的合法性形成初步判断。

步骤二:理解权限内容

每个dApp在申请权限时,都会展示具体的权限内容,包括允许访问哪些资产、进行哪些操作等。用户需要仔细阅读并理解这些信息,确保没有隐藏的风险。例如,一个dApp可能要求访问您所有的代币资产,而这种要求就需要用户谨慎对待,确保这是合理的。

步骤三:仅授权必要的权限

在很多情况下,用户并不需要授权全部的权限。例如,某个dApp可能只需要读访问的权限,而不需要改变资产的权限。在此情况下,用户应当选择最小权限原则,尽可能仅授权必要的权限,以降低风险。

步骤四:定期检查授权状态

用户完成权限授权后,应定期检查已授权的dApp和权限状态。这可以通过钱包的界面进行操作,若发现某个dApp的权限没有使用,用户应及时撤销权限,以恢复对资产的控制。

步骤五:保持钱包安全

最后,用户还需要采用良好的安全习惯,保护自己的数字钱包。这包括定期更换密码、不随意分享私钥、启用双重认证等,以确保在任何情况下都能保护好自己的资产。

常见问题解析

Web3与传统网络的权限管理有什么区别?

Web3与传统网络的权限管理在许多方面存在显著区别:

去中心化 vs. 中心化

传统互联网大多是由中心化的服务提供商控制,用户的数据由这些服务商进行管理。权限管理往往依赖于中心化的数据库,而数据泄露和滥用的风险也随之增加。相对而言,Web3强调去中心化,用户的数据与资产都由用户自己掌控,更加安全。

智能合约的使用

Web3的权限管理主要依赖智能合约来执行和执行权限。用户在进入dApp时,通过与智能合约交互来授权,而不是向某个中心化平台进行身份验证。这种方式提高了透明性与可追溯性,但也更需要用户理解智能合约的逻辑与风险。

用户主权

传统互联网用户往往被束缚于某个特定平台,失去对自身数据和隐私的控制。而在Web3环境中,用户可以在不同的dApp之间自由选择,享受更高的自主性与权益。

如果我错误地授权了一个dApp,该如何处理?

当用户在Web3中错误地授权了一个dApp后,可以采取以下步骤:

及时撤销授权

最重要的一点是,用户应迅速检查已授权的dApp,立即撤销不必要的权限。大多数数字钱包,如MetaMask,提供了查看和管理已授权的功能。

评估风险

用户需要评估可能风险的程度,包括已授权dApp的潜在恶性行为以及目前的资产安全状况。这有助于用户决定是否需要更进一步的安全措施,例如转移资产。

增强安全措施

如果用户发现自己授权的dApp确实存在安全风险,除了撤销权限外,用户还应开启更多的安全措施来保护钱包。这包括更改密码、启用二次验证等。

Web3的权限申请流程复杂吗?

Web3的权限申请流程在某些方面比较复杂,但一旦理解了流程逻辑,参与者会发现其中的便利。具体来说:

用户教育不足

Web3的某些技术概念 对于许多用户来说仍然比较陌生,包括钱包、智能合约等。加之许多dApp的设计界面不够友好,导致用户在申请权限时感到困惑。

用户体验与安全的平衡

在保障安全性的同时,dApp开发者还需要考虑用户的使用体验。这使得在设计权限申请流程时,开发者需要在安全与便利之间取得平衡,注重用户引导。

需要技术知识

尽管很多dApp在权限申请时提供了清晰的提示和说明,但部分细节仍需要用户具备一定的技术知识,才能完全理解其背后的机制。因此,对于非技术用户而言,这一过程可能显得复杂。

如何评估一个dApp的权限申请是否合理?

评估一个dApp的权限申请是否合理,可以通过以下几个方面来进行:

具体权限的透明度

用户需要仔细检查dApp申请的具体权限,确保其与dApp的功能相匹配。例如,一个简单的NFT浏览应用通常不应申请管理用户钱包资产的权限。

查看社区反馈

用户应关注其他开发者和使用者对该dApp的反馈,社区的一致评价对于评估其合理性有重要参考价值。查阅论坛、社交媒体讨论,有助于了解该dApp是否存在安全隐患。

开发者背景的审查

如能了解dApp开发者的背景及其贡献的项目,有助于用户判断该dApp的可信度。声誉良好的开发者一般会对其项目进行更严格的安全管理。

Web3的未来会如何影响权限管理的方式?

随着Web3技术的不断成熟,未来权限管理可能会迎来一系列改变:

更智能的权限管理系统

未来,Web3可能会实现更加智能的权限管理系统,利用人工智能和机器学习等技术自动评估和用户的权限申请过程,为用户提供量身定制的权限管理方案。

用户教育的普及

随着Web3的普及和相关教育的加强,用户将更加了解如何安全地申请权限。这将促进用户更自觉地管理自己的数据和资产安全。

去中心化治理的兴起

随着去中心化自治组织(DAO)的崛起,用户将有机会参与权限管理的制定过程。通过社区投票的方式,用户可以共同设定合理的权限标准,提升整体的安全信任度。

结语

在Web3的世界中,权限管理是每个用户都需要面对的重要课题。理解如何安全申请权限,不仅可以保护个人资产,还能提升用户的整体体验。通过学习和应用相关知识,用户可以在这个快速发展的领域中,找到属于自己的位置,并安全地享受Web3带来的各种创新服务。